Proper maintenance extends the life of your tools and ensures they perform at their best. Dull mower blades tear grass instead of cutting it cleanly, creating brown tips and opening the door to disease. No — any mower can create basic stripes, but a rear roller or striping kit attachment produces much bolder, longer-lasting results. Many modern walk-behind mowers include a built-in rear roller that handles striping without any extras.
